It's been a long week for Iowa, coming off of a loss against one of the worst teams in the FBS, lowly Minnesota. But the Hawkeyes appear to be trying to make up for it this week, and enter halftime leading ranked Michigan 17-6.
Iowa's James Vandenberg is 9-of-12 for 114 yards and a touchdown passing, while Marcus Coker has chipped in 74 yards and a touchdown on 15 carries. Denard Robinson has been less successful for Michigan, completing six of his 13 passing attempts for 64 yards, a touchdown and an interception. (Michigan missed the extra point.) He's rushed for just 10 yards, though his longest run went for 19. Fitzgerald Toussaint has 46 yards on nine carries to lead the Wolverines on the ground.
Of course, Iowa led Minnesota 21-10 in the fourth quarter before losing that one. So don't give up on Michigan in this one just yet.
